This week Nikki has asked us to Just Add a Colour Combo, with a twist ... you get to pick your own third colour! 



My colour of choice was Pool Party! 




Red, pink with a light teal shade of blue (Pool Party) is such a lovely classic colour combo. I used Pool Party as my grounding shade and for the foliage and that let me go to town with the pink and red for my flowers. Stitching adds some subtle texture, while the black twine adds some drama, and of course some sequins and Wink of Stella add sparkle.

I have a fairly simple little project for you today - but then that's what you need in the lead up to Christmas!



A close up


I made quite a few of these delightful little boxes, but kept it fun and fresh for me by making them in a whole range of different colour ways. I was quite astonished with how much chocolate you could actually fit into these! The tag is almost bigger than the boxes but I was still having so much fun playing with my Festival of Trees set and punch that I just had to dress up the boxes.

For a little time on my part and a whole lot of inky fun I also had the added bonus of making people smile when they received one of these!

Recipe: All SU! unless otherwise noted
Stamps: Festival of Trees
Cardstock: Real Red, Old Olive, Whisper White
Ink: Real Red, Old Olive
Accessories: Curvy Keepsake box thinlets, Scalloped Tag Topper punch, Tree punch, Itty Bitty Accents punch pack, Champagne glimmer paper, Season of Style DSP stack (R), Gold baker's twine, Dimensionals, Double sided tape (X Press)
